
نور الدين وليد
03 عضو مميز-
Posts
160 -
تاريخ الانضمام
-
تاريخ اخر زياره
نوع المحتوي
المنتدى
مكتبة الموقع
معرض الصور
المدونات
الوسائط المتعددة
كل منشورات العضو نور الدين وليد
-
خطا فى تصميم التقرير عند الطباعة
نور الدين وليد replied to نور الدين وليد's topic in قسم الأكسيس Access
للرفع -
كيف استعلم عن عنوان كتاب طويل بكلمة واحدة منه؟
نور الدين وليد replied to ابو حجون's topic in قسم الأكسيس Access
تفضل اخى الحل مرفق مكتبة.rar فى الاستعلام book as باستخدام like وهذه فكرة اخرى ايضا تغنيك عن الاستعلام تماما وهى استخدام كومبو بوكس للبحث فى النموذج ويكون مصدرها حقل اسم الكتاب من الجدول مرتب ابجديا- للتسهيل - ولاتنسى ان تجعل مصدرالبيانات فى الفورم الجدول وليس الاستعلام وهذا فائدته انك نبحث عن الكتاب بكامل اسمه دون كتابه ولن تحتاج للتفريق بين( "أ،ا،إ " او "ي،ى") وغيرها مكتبة1.rar -
بالنسبة للكود الذى ذكره الاخ رمهان فهو يحل تلك المشكلة [pay]-If(IsNull([loan]);0;[loan]) -[pay] تعنى الحقل pay طرح وبدلا من وضع loan بعد علامة الطرح نضع الجملة الشرطية if كما يلى If(IsNull([loan]) هنا نضع الشرط اذا كان حقل الخصومات فارغا ;0 هنا اذا كان الشرط صحيح يصرح من حقل الراتب 0 ;[loan] هنا اذا كان الشرط غير صحيح اى الخصم لايساوى 0 اطرح من الراتب حق الخصم ارجوا ان اكون شرحت الكود بشكل واضح اود ان اضيف الى ماقاله الاستاذ رمهان يمكنك ان تستخدم الكود الاول مع جعل القيمة الافتراضية للحقل الخصم ="0" فيتم الطرح مباشرة بالتوفيق
-
فعلا انا عندى 2010 ولكن لم اعرف هذه الخاصية الا الآن فعلا معلومة مفيدة واحتجتها كثيرا جزاك الله خيرا
-
لا توجد مشاكل تحدث معى عند تحميل او تنزيل المرفقات
-
السلام عليكم على حد علمى لا يمكن عمل عمليات حسابية مباشرة فى الجدول ولكن يمكن عمل ذلك فى الاستعلام او الفورم كما يلى sub-pay.rar
-
خطا فى تصميم التقرير عند الطباعة
نور الدين وليد replied to نور الدين وليد's topic in قسم الأكسيس Access
اقصد ان لاحظت ان المعلومات فى التقرير تظهر على صفحتين اعنى كل صفحة تظهر على 2 لان المعلومات كثيرة واكبر من عرض الصفحة هذا ما قصد وبالتالى حين تكون التقرير من اليمين الى اليسار تظهر الصفحة بالترتيب كما بالصورة اما من اليسار لليمين تظهر بالعكس من الاسفل للاعلى كما مبين بالصور ارجو ان اكون وضحت طلبى وجزاك الله خيرا -
https://drive.google.com/open?id=0BxKxrloSKc-TRE5CTGd6RU1fYnM تفضل هذا الرابط لتحميل البرنامج شرح.rar
-
خطا فى تصميم التقرير عند الطباعة
نور الدين وليد replied to نور الدين وليد's topic in قسم الأكسيس Access
جزاك الله خيرا ولكن بما ان التقرير من اليسار لليمين يتم عرض الصفحات من اليسار لليمين فى الطباعة وبما ان كل صفحة تظهر على صفحتين بالطباعة تكون الطباعة صعبة فهل من حل لهذه المشكلة وجزاك الله خيرا -
خطا فى تصميم التقرير عند الطباعة
نور الدين وليد replied to نور الدين وليد's topic in قسم الأكسيس Access
طب هل يمكن شرح الحل لانى احتاجه ضرورى؟ وجزاكم الله خيرا على الاهتمام -
خطا فى تصميم التقرير عند الطباعة
نور الدين وليد replied to نور الدين وليد's topic in قسم الأكسيس Access
للرفع -
خطا فى تصميم التقرير عند الطباعة
نور الدين وليد replied to نور الدين وليد's topic in قسم الأكسيس Access
المثال غير مرفق هل يمكن اذا لم يمكن رفع المثال شرح الحل ؟ وجزاك الله خيرا على الاهتمام -
السلام عليكم لدى برنامج لادارة شؤون الموظفين عندى تقرير عام يظهر جميع الموظفين وبما ان البيانات كثيرة تظهر كل صفحة على صفحتين وعندا يكون هناك 80 موظف مثلا يظهر التقرير على 8 صفحات فى كل صفحة 20 موظف مقسومين على صفحتين المشكلة فى الصفحة الثالثة تظهر اخطاء فى العناوين ولا اعرف السبب هليوجد حل لهذه المشكلة اعتذر فقد يكون الشرح غير واضح ولكن المرفق مرفوع ويمكن المقارنة بين عرض التقرير فى طور الطباعة وطور التصميم New Microsoft Access Database.rar
-
تفضل الفكرة كما يلى انشاء جدول خاص بامور الطباعة يتكون من حقل رقم الفاتورة مربوط بجدول الفواتير من خلال هذا الحقل ثم انشاء فورم من نوع ورقة بيانات datasheet خاص بالجدول انشاء تقرير الفواتير كما بالمثال السابق ووضع نفس التكست الخاص بالتاريخ والوقت والمستخدم بالطريقة السابقة فى الحدث load ل التقرير قم باضافة كود يفتح الفورم الخاص بجدول الطباعة المنشئ سابقا علو الوضع add فى الحدث load للفورم قم بوضع كود لاخذ البيانات من التقرير ثم اتلحفظ والاغلاق البرنامج مرفق مع التعديل وبالله التوفيق Database1.rar
-
فى تصميم استعلام اكتب فى الشرط الخاص بحقل الراتب is not null وهى تعنى ليس فارغ هذا اذاكان حقل الرواتب رقم عادى اعنى اذا لم تكتب فيه شئ يبقى فارغ اما اذا كانت عامل قيمته الافتراضية دائما 0 مثلا استبدل الشرط اعلاه ب not=0 مثال.rar
-
الوقت والتاريخ اضف تكست واكتب فيه ()Now= بالنسبة للمستخدم باعتبار ان هناك جدول خاص بالمستخدمين وفورم خاص بالدخول وليكن اسمه login وحقل اسم المستخدم اسمه user سوف تضيف تكست وتكتب فيه =[forms]![login]![user] بشرط ان يكون نموذج الدخول غير مغلق اى عند الدخول قم باخفاء النموذج بدلا من اغلاقه توضيح مرفق New Microsoft Access Database.rar
-
تفضل البرنامج بعد التعديل المطلوب اضافة سجل حديد فى الحدث load للفورم الخاص بالمستندات لان الفورم يفتح على اول سجل ويعتبر كود تغيير رقم الطلب تعديل على اول سجل يفتح عليه الجملة التكرارية فى الحدث load لفورم المستندات تقوم بالتاكد من عدم وجود مستندات خاصة بهذا الطلب حتى لا يقوم البرنامج باضافة سجلين لنفس رقم الطلب ويعطى خطا تكرار بالتوفيق ان شاء الله StudentsRegister0.rar
-
يمكن اخفاء الجزء الخاص بالتنقل تماما وذلك عن طربق زر اوفيس واختيار options واختيار current database ثم من جزء navigation الغى الصح من display navigation pane
-
تحديث بيانات نموذج من خلال نموذج اخر
نور الدين وليد replied to wael_rafat's topic in قسم الأكسيس Access
انا جربت المثال عندى يعمل هذا مثال مرفق requery.rar -
جزاك الله خيرا اعتذر لم اشاهد الرد الا متاخرا
-
جزاك الله خيرا سوف اجرب البرنامج